Code P174A Audi Description

The P174A code for Audi indicates a valve 3 in the sub-gearbox 1 electric fault. This fault typically points to an issue with the electronic components controlling the valve in the transmission system. The valve plays a crucial role in regulating the flow of hydraulic fluid within the gearbox, which is essential for smooth gear shifts and overall transmission performance. When this valve malfunctions, it can lead to various problems with the transmission system, affecting the vehicle's drivability and potentially causing long-term damage if left unaddressed.

Common Causes of P174A Audi

  1. Faulty valve solenoid: The most common cause of this code is a malfunctioning valve solenoid, which controls the operation of the valve in the transmission system.
  2. Wiring issues: Electrical problems such as damaged wiring, loose connections, or short circuits can also trigger this fault code.
  3. Faulty transmission control module (TCM): A malfunctioning TCM can disrupt the communication between the electronic components in the transmission system, leading to this fault.
  4. Mechanical issues: Internal damage or wear and tear within the transmission system can also contribute to the valve 3 electric fault.

Symptoms of P174A Audi

  1. Erratic shifting behavior
  2. Harsh gear changes
  3. Transmission slipping
  4. Illuminated check engine light
  5. Reduced fuel efficiency

How to Fix P174A Audi

  1. Diagnose the fault code: Use a diagnostic scanner to retrieve the specific fault code and identify the exact location of the issue within the transmission system.
  2. Inspect the valve and solenoid: Check the condition of the valve and solenoid for any signs of damage or wear. Replace any faulty components as needed.
  3. Check wiring and connections: Inspect the wiring harness and connections associated with the valve for any damage or loose connections. Repair or replace any faulty wiring.
  4. Test transmission control module: Verify the functionality of the TCM by conducting a thorough diagnostic test to ensure proper communication with the electronic components.
  5. Clear fault codes and test drive: Once the repairs are completed, clear the fault codes from the system and test drive the vehicle to confirm that the issue has been resolved.

Cost to Fix P174A Audi

The typical repair costs for addressing a valve 3 in the sub-gearbox 1 electric fault in an Audi can range from $300 to $800, depending on the extent of the repairs needed and the cost of parts and labor. This estimate includes the cost of replacing the valve solenoid, inspecting and repairing wiring issues, and testing the TCM. It's important to note that the actual repair costs may vary based on the specific di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ops, which can be influenced by fact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and engine type. It is recommended to consult with a qualified mechanic or service center to obtain a more accurate estimate based on the individual circumstances of the vehicle.
